Output 2b76b1072b6300c60ee95b573e20a9ed90808b000b9aea2aa79a26a5deb0f4a1:18

value
40762
script pubkey
OP_0 OP_PUSHBYTES_20 43ad66bbdad42df6cf3d72d15dbce7800869ca85
address
bc1qgwkkdw766skldneawtg4m088sqyxnj59wcmlqh
transaction
2b76b1072b6300c60ee95b573e20a9ed90808b000b9aea2aa79a26a5deb0f4a1
spent
true